Dorn Method
The Dorn Method offers a gentle and effective approach to musculoskeletal health, particularly beneficial for individuals experiencing persistent pain.
Developed in the 1980s in Germany, this method is based on traditional techniques historically used in the Alps to treat back pain, where access to medical professionals was limited.
The Dorn Method employs principles of anatomy, physics, and biomechanics to effectively realign the body’s structural system. It primarily targets misalignments in the spinal column and other joints to relieve nerve impingements. By realigning the body's structure and correcting muscular imbalances, the method aims to restore optimal biomechanical function. These adjustments can enhance neuromuscular communication, potentially reducing pain and improving overall body efficiency.
During treatment, practitioners use gentle counter-pressure combined with dynamic movements to correct misalignments in the spine and other joints, ensuring the process is comfortable and safe for the patient.

Empowerment Through Self-HelpA fundamental aspect of the Dorn Method is empowering patients to manage their own treatment. During sessions, clients learn straightforward exercises that they can perform independently at home. These exercises are integral to the treatment process, helping to sustain a painfree live.
The Dorn Method not only alleviates pain but also enhances body awareness, improving posture and movement. This increased understanding helps prevent future injuries and promotes better overall physical health.

Gentle Spinal Decompression
- The Swiss Swing Pillow Spine Therapy, also known in German as Wirbelsäulen-Basis-Ausgleich (WBA) by Rolf Ott, utilises a unique therapeutic approach that integrates classical massage, stretching, and myofascial release techniques. This method targets spinal alignment and promotes well-being by passively mobilising the spine.
- During a session, clients lie prone on specialised inflatable pillows that enable gentle oscillation. This oscillation is crucial as it facilitates a rhythmic motion of the spine. This gentle movement subtly alters the position of the vertebrae, aiding in the correction of blockages and misalignments that can cause pain and discomfort. It eases tension in the spinal muscles and reduces pressure on the intervertebral discs.
- The decrease in spinal pressure and the improved circulation from the movement enhance fluid exchange, contributing to a healthier metabolism in the spinal joints.
- Increased Fluid Exchange: Boosts the delivery of nutrients and removal of waste products in joint and disc tissues, enhancing recovery.
- Enhanced Joint Healing: Supports the healing processes in the spinal joints, potentially easing pain and increasing mobility.
